5 Fantastic – and Free – Things To Do in Chicago With the Kids

Lincoln Park Zoo (Photo: Alisa Farov/Shutterstock)

Kids may be small, but they’re certainly expensive! Luckily, some of Chicago’s best attractions are free — or offer a special kid-friendly rate — so you can enjoy the best of the city without emptying out your checking account. Here are five gratis things to do in Chicago with the fam:

  1. Chicago Botanic Garden. Small scouts will enjoy the trek outside the city to this beautiful garden oasis, and it’ll only cost you to park. With families top of mind, there is always some fun activity happening here, from free outdoor concerts to “nature nights” — all set to a gorgeous backdrop.
  2. Maggie Daley Park. This brand new park has all the latest bells and whistles, from a free skating ribbon, a climbing wall, a life-sized play ship and a three-level tube slide. It may have cost the city a pretty penny to build, but it won’t cost you anything to visit.
  3. Lincoln Park Zoo. Not only is the zoo free, it truly is one of the best places to visit in all of Chicago. For $3, spring for the new Lionel train ride that will cart your family through the zoo. Then, head towards the nature boardwalk, where kids can let off some steam by running along the docks and checking out the local birds and amphibians.
  4. Chicago History Museum. Kids 12 and under get in free to this interactive museum dedicated exclusively to the city’s rich history. Kids can try their hand at building bridges, be a Chicago style hot dog and learn about the great Chicago fire.
  5. Green City Market. If you time your visit right, you can catch a rainbow of fruits and vegetables at this Lincoln Park farmer’s market in full glory. Grab a sample or snack from one of the many Midwest vendors, listen to some music and enjoy the hustle and bustle of the park. Your kids may even go home vegetable lovers … or not.
